My eufySecurity Device is Warm to Touch

Like any other electronic device, eufySecurity devices release heat when they are in working mode, such as streaming audio, recording movements and sending push notifications.

Moreover, cameras and doorbells will produce heat when they are being powered. We have provided four tips shown below to protect your camera or doorbell from overheating.

1. Be conscious of the working temperature. 

The camera or doorbell should work from -4°F to 122°F (-20°C - 50°C).

2. Do not expose the camera or doorbell to direct sunlight. 

Place it under a shade or mount the camera or doorbell under an eave to keep it cool.

3. Place it in a ventilated place

If the camera or doorbell has been mounted into a box, please make sure air can flow freely.

4. Don't place clothes or other materials to hide the camera or doorbell.
